Emergency H2O Line Repair: Factors and Solutions

Unexpected water main breaks can happen due to a number of causes. Common culprits comprise earth shifting, plant intrusion exerting pressure on the lines, corrosion over length, and extreme climate like freezing temperatures. Addressing these situations typically involves immediate removal to get to the broken portion of the line. Solutions might range from a basic repair to a total line substitution, and often require short-term water service outages for residents. Proactive inspections can help lessen the chance of future breaks.

Cost of Water Main Repair: A Comprehensive Guide

Facing a problem with your water main can be incredibly disruptive , and understanding the potential cost of repair is a crucial first move . The overall price tag can vary widely, typically ranging from $500 to $10,000 or even higher , depending on several aspects. These encompass the severity of the damage, the sort of material needing replacement (like copper, PVC, or ductile iron), the site of the break – whether it's easily accessible or requires difficult digging – and local workmanship rates. Furthermore, permitting charges and emergency service fees can also increase the eventual expense. Getting multiple bids from qualified plumbers is highly advised to ensure you’re receiving a fair price and a complete assessment of the situation .

Water Main Repair Permits & Regulations Explained

Obtaining a permit for public main repair can be a complex process, dictated by regional ordinances . Typically , homeowners and contractors must submit detailed designs outlining the scope of the project to the governing agency . This includes specifying the supplies to be used, procedures for the digging and reinstatement of the area, and adherence to all pertinent safety standards . Furthermore , regulations frequently address ground control, vehicle management during the construction , and the proper backfilling and compaction of the excavation. Failure to comply with these codes can result in penalties and a delay to the repair . It's crucial to contact your local public works department ahead of commencing any construction.

Preventative Water Main Repair: Extending Lifespan

Proactive care of your potable main pipe is crucial for avoiding costly failures and increasing its lifespan . Rather than addressing to unexpected repairs, a regular preventative approach involving thorough evaluations and targeted repairs can substantially decrease the probability of large disruptions and preserve the condition of your network. This approach often includes things like finding leaks , corrosion prevention and early substitutions of weakened sections, ultimately reducing costs and ensuring a more dependable water supply for a long time ahead .
